Do you wonder, are Polaris side by sides made in the United States? We can safely say that Polaris has a U.S.-based supply chain. Polaris Inc. is an American company renowned for manufacturing off-road vehicles, including utility vehicles like side-by-sides and ATVs. Its production facilities are based in Wisconsin and Minnesota. This company is proud of its American-made vehicles and has a strong reputation for quality and innovation.

A little bit of history

Although Polaris was founded in Roseau, Minnesota, its headquarters are in Medina, Minnesota. The company was first named Polaris Industries, Inc. and was renamed in 2019 to Polaris, Inc. It was in 1995 that Polaris started making ATVs, which brought the company great success and fame.

In 2010, Polaris relocated some of its utility and sports vehicle assembly to Mexico. Some components are now manufactured in Osceola, Wisconsin, while the Polaris vehicle assembly is completed in Roseau, Minnesota.

More About Polaris Side by Sides

Side by side vehicles are known for their unique design. Their seating arrangements are organized with the driver and passenger sitting side by side rather than one in front of the other, as seen on motorcycles and some larger ATVs. They usually have four wheels, a frame, and a cage for added safety. Many models have power steering and a high-performance engine, which allows for a smooth driving experience.

A Polaris side by side has many uses, from recreational activities to industrial and agricultural purposes. Many farmers and ranchers use side by sides to access remote areas, haul, or tow trailers. These vehicles are popular for off-road adventures, like exploring landscapes, hunting, fishing, or even participating in outdoor sports.
